Following an acclaimed world premiere performance at Mercat de les Flors in Barcelona, HUMANHOOD Dance Company bring ∞ {Infinite}, a new dance piece to The Lowry.

This UK premiere is described as a “dance theatre meditation”, an entrancing blend of words and movement performed on stage by the company’s exceptional world-class dancers. Distinctive, hypnotic and thoughtful, ∞ {Infinite} invites its audience to meditate on their own internal power and celebrate the infinite possibilities of the future.

Presented as part of this year’s Birmingham International Dance Festival (BIDF), co-produced by Mercat de les Flors and receiving its UK premiere at The Lowry, ∞ {Infinite} by HUMANHOOD Dance Company will feature elements of positive mindset, wellness and mindfulness alongside dream-like dance and powerful tribal beats.

Founded in 2016 by Catalan and Birmingham born artists Júlia Robert and Rudi Cole, HUMANHOOD Dance Company have earned a sterling reputation in the UK and on international dance scenes. Previous award-winning works, Zero and Torus, have been performed in the UK and around the world. The company’s outdoor pieces, Orbis and Sphera, were presented as part of the Sadler’s Wells and BBC Arts’ acclaimed ‘Dancing Nation’ mini-series alongside celebrated artists like Matthew Bourne’s New Adventures, Rambert and Akram Khan.

HUMANHOOD Dance Company seek to raise human consciousness and empower human potential with their highly spiritual, and always thrilling, dance productions. Through their work – which is often inspired by physics, human consciousness and Eastern philosophies – Robert and Cole aim to create a unique and deeply engaging experience for the audience. Drawing on science and Eastern mysticism, ∞ {Infinite} is the company’s first production to blend stunning choreography with shamanic ritual.

Of ∞ {Infinite}, Artistic Directors of HUMANHOOD Júlia Robert and Rudi Cole said, “The time has come for us to break out of our shell and share with the world the fusion of our spiritual practice with our artistic voice. ∞ {Infinite} is the culmination of decades of metaphysical experiences around the world, and our vision to take audiences to a brand-new theatre experience. This is our first dance theatre meditation marking an exciting chapter in HUMANHOOD’s expansion. For us, the theatre is a modern-day temple, a place where the hearts and minds of many can come together as one, to allow new ideas to enter the imagination and challenge our thinking of the universe and ourselves as a part of it.”

Fluid and celebratory, ∞ {Infinite} sees the theatre auditorium transformed into a sacred space as the dancers become vessels for the creative process, bridging the link between spirituality and artistic expression. A fascinating and enveloping performative blend of physics and ancient ideologies, ∞ {Infinite} juxtaposes age-old tradition and civilisation with modern, electrifying choreography.

Audiences can expect to be guided through a powerful, mystical journey during HUMANHOOD Dance Company’s visionary 60-minute dance show. The performance will also be followed by a post-show talk by the company.
